Have you ever been afraid to talk back when you are unfairly treated? Have you ever bought something just because the salesman talked you into it? Are you afraid to ask someone for a date?(17)Many people are afraid to assert themselves. Or. Robert Albert, author of Stand Up, Speak Out, and Talk Back, thinks it’s because their self-respect is now. "There is always a ’superior’ around—a parent, a teacher, a boss—who knows better." But Albeit and other scientists are doing something to help people assert themselves. They offer "Assertiveness Training" course.(18)In the AT course, people learn that they have a right to be themselves. They learn to speak out and feel good about doing so. They learn to be aggressive without hurting other people. In other way, learning to speak out is to overcome fear.(19)A group taking an AT course will help the timid person to lose his fear. But AT uses an even stronger motive—the need to share. The timid person speaks out in the group because he wants to tell how he feels.(20)Whether or not you speak out for yourself depends on your se1f-image. If someone you face is more important than you, you may start to doubt your own good sense. But why should you? AT says that you can get to feel good about yourself. And once you do, you can learn to speak out.
17. What is the problem the speaker mainly talks about?
18. Which of the following is done in an AT course?
19. What is suggested to the timid persons to overcome their problems?
20. Why are some people afraid to speak out for themselves?
选项
A、Some people buy things they do not want.
B、Some people are afraid to behave in a confident manner.
C、There are many superiors around us.
D、Some people think too highly of themselves.
答案
B
解析
短文开始部分提出了一些人在生活中存在的一些问题,如导怕表现自己、不能坚持己见等。因此,B)“…些人害怕自信地表现自己”符合题意。
